私は、(少なくとも) 2 つの異なるユーザー タイプ (たとえば、買い手と売り手) を持つアプリケーションを構築しています。各ユーザー タイプには独自のロジック (登録フォーム/プロセス、プロファイル、権限など) が必要ですが、いくつかの点で共通の管理を行うために、各ユーザーで FOSUserBundle を使用したいと考えています。
私は実際に登録フォームによってブロックされています。さまざまなフォームを FOSUserBundle に宣言できないことがあり、いくつかの調査の後、それは不可能に思えます。私が見つけたいくつかの回答は、自分の登録フォームを使用することを提案していますが、その後
FOSUserBundle とリンクする方法は?
controllers/forms の user テーブルに自分自身を入力する必要がありますか? このようにして、さまざまなユーザーが FOSUserBundle からユーザーをすべて拡張し、 FOSUserBundle からそれらを拡張せずにさまざまなフォームを自分で管理する必要がありますか?
事前に感謝